Noun auricula has 2 senses
  1. auricula, bear's ear, Primula auricula - yellow-flowered primrose native to Alps; commonly cultivated
    --1 is a kind of primrose, primula
  2. auricula, auricular appendage, auricular appendix - a pouch projecting from the top front of each atrium of the heart
    --2 is a kind of pouch, pocket
    --2 is a part of atrium cordis, atrium of the heart